Description

2-Bromo-3-Pyridyl Trifluoromethanesulfonate is a high-value triflate ester building block, specifically functionalized on the pyridine ring. This compound is essential for facilitating challenging cross-coupling reactions, enabling the efficient synthesis of complex molecules in advanced research and development. It is primarily sought after by pharmaceutical, agrochemical, and advanced materials chemists for constructing novel active ingredients and functional materials.

Application

  • Pharmaceutical Intermediate: A key precursor in the synthesis of active pharmaceutical ingredients (APIs), particularly for kinase inhibitors and other small-molecule therapeutics.
  • Agrochemical Synthesis: Used in the development of novel herbicides, fungicides, and insecticides, leveraging its reactivity for structure-activity relationship (SAR) studies.
  • Cross-Coupling Reactions: Serves as an excellent electrophile in palladium-catalyzed reactions such as Suzuki, Negishi, and Stille couplings to introduce the 2-bromo-3-pyridyl moiety.
  • Ligand and Material Science: Employed in the creation of specialized ligands for catalysis and as a building block for organic electronic materials.
  • Chemical Research & Development: A versatile reagent for medicinal chemistry and process chemistry in both academic and industrial R&D laboratories.

Basic Information

Product Name 2-Bromo-3-Pyridyl Trifluoromethanesulfonate
CAS No. 157373-97-2
Molecular Formula C7H3BrF3NO3S
Molecular Weight 317.07 g/mol
Synonyms 2-Bromo-3-pyridyl triflate; 2-Bromo-3-pyridinyl trifluoromethanesulfonate; 3-Bromo-2-pyridyl trifluoromethanesulfonate; Trifluoromethanesulfonic acid 2-bromo-3-pyridyl ester; 2-Bromo-3-trifluoromethanesulfonyloxypyridine; (2-Bromopyridin-3-yl) trifluoromethanesulfonate; 157373-97-2

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en or argon) to prevent moisture absorption and decomposition.
